JULIUS BERSTL

8 Boxes

Scope/Content:

Literary archive of the German emigre author (1883-1975), containing typescripts, manuscripts, and correspondence and clipping files in English and German.

Provenance: Donated by Mr. Berstl in 1975.

Biography:

Born on August 6, 1883 in Bernburg, Germany to a theatrical family; after studying German and English literature at the universities of Goettingen and Leipzig, he was the dramaturgist, or literary adviser, of the renowned Barnowsky theaters in Berlin from 1909-1924, and was also a novelist and playwright; emigrated in 1936 to England; in 1943 became a scriptwriter and translator for the London BBC, for which he wrote 60 radio dramas, many on biblical themes; translated works by J. B. Priestley, Coward, and Daphne du Maurier; moved in 1951 to New York City, and after the death of his wife in 1964, to Santa Barbara, CA, where he died in 1975.
